Output 94c57c7228bc2cf7968142777f78a241e5211f087e2a4ebea904245eb0ea8ce4:0

value
3086051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c580145624acb690d8efd3f7b392922ab11704a OP_EQUAL
address
3QhHdaRu1CmrbAMPAZ6heE1xaX2y3mAsdL
transaction
94c57c7228bc2cf7968142777f78a241e5211f087e2a4ebea904245eb0ea8ce4
spent
true